## Shipping Fee Rules Engine

Welcome aboard. The Cartwhistle rules engine decides shipping fees for every order — weight bands, zone surcharges, promo overrides, the works. Rules live as YAML in `rules/live/` and get compiled at deploy time, so don't edit anything on a running node. To test a rule change, run `cartwhistle simulate` against the Pellbrook staging evaluator, which covers all zones. The simulator authenticates with the staging service key, pasted here for convenience:

service key, kaduf-bawig: kto15_Ze79S0dligTw0yO

Subject: Handover — contrast audit rollout

Hey Priyan,

Passing the baton while I'm out. The color-contrast accessibility audit on Tintrella flagged 42 components; the fixes land in release 7.3 tonight. Most are token swaps, but the chart palette changed visibly, so expect a few "why does it look different" pings. Rollback plan is in the runbook if contrast regressions pop up on mobile. To push or roll back the bundle, the deploy key is below.

rollout seal: bky4_x7Gc

Subject: Handover — Matchwell GC pause investigation

Hi Doran,

Taking over the Matchwell pager from me: the matching service sees 800ms+ garbage-collection pauses during peak pairing windows, which starve the connection pool and surface as timeouts downstream. I've pinned the allocator logs and heap dumps in the shared vault. Please keep sampling at 5-minute intervals until the heap tuning lands. The pause metrics table lives in the ops database, reachable via the string below.

replica DSN, kajep-yahag: mssql://praok_svc:iF@db-8d68.plorvaio.local:5432/eliion